
Aims and Scope
This unique book will help researchers, instructors, and students in econometrics to reach a deeper understanding of the mathematical and statistical calculations of econometrics. Mathematica software permits rapid numerical, symbolic, and graphic calculations that allow complex concepts to be displayed, animated, and discussed in the same document. In the e-book version of this book Mathematica is used as a tool to display, animate, and calculate various statistical calculations: No programming by the instructor or the reader is needed to activate these functions. The Tutorials are "interactive" in that the user not only enters but may also change the values of parameters within the code in order to better understand difficult concepts.
The e-book will continue to serve the researcher as a computational "toolbox" for the common calculations needed to perform a variety of econometrical analyses. While the Mathematica software is needed to run the Tutorials, it can be applied to any number of additional mathematical or scientific applications.
Aimed at advanced graduate students, applied mathematicians, econometrics, and practioneers, the work will be an excellent self-study reference or supplementary textbook in courses focusing on econometrics.
The book is written by an econometrics lecturer who knows the difficulties involved in applying mathematics to real problems. Many exercises are included at the end of each chapter.
